Re: US Cellular HTC Titan/6800 Original Settings USCC

I'd double-check all the settings found here
Lookin @ the screenshots, it shows active user profile is set to 0

So make sure you are changing the values on the 'default' m.ip profile

With Sprint, the M.IP Profile 1 is used for data authentication, not M.IP Profile 0 (also known as default) - perhaps you could try changing the active profile to 1 and then making all the changes for M.IP Profile 0 to M.IP Profile 1? unno... i'm not 100% sure when it comes to USCC devices. Anyway, if you figure it out please post back...
